
Title: The Erosion of Putin’s Global Influence: A Closer Look at Russia’s Struggling Allies As we delve into the intricacies of international politics, it becomes increasingly clear that Vladimir Putin’s global standing has taken a significant hit in recent times. With allies such as Venezuela, Syria, and Iran facing various challenges – from being picked off to being bombed – Putin’s once-promising promises now seem hollow at best, and his lies less convincing than ever before. Historically speaking, Russia has always sought to expand its influence by forging strategic alliances with countries that share similar ideologies or face common adversaries. In the case of Venezuela, Syria, and Iran, these nations have been crucial in helping Moscow maintain a foothold on the global stage while also serving as counterweights against Western powers like the United States and Europe. However, recent events have exposed the fragility of these alliances. The ongoing crisis in Venezuela has seen Russia’s influence wane amidst widespread protests and economic turmoil. Meanwhile, Syria continues to face relentless bombing campaigns led by various international forces, leaving Moscow scrambling for solutions while its ally suffers. Lastly, Iran finds itself at odds with the United States once again, leading many to question whether Putin’s promises of support will hold true in times of crisis. The implications of these developments cannot be overstated. As Russia loses ground on multiple fronts, it becomes increasingly difficult for Moscow to maintain its status as a global power player. This shift could have far-reaching consequences not only for Putin’s administration but also for the international community at large. With fewer allies willing or able to stand by Russia in times of need, Moscow may find itself isolated and unable to exert influence over key geopolitical issues.
